
它以其直观的操作界面、强大的功能以及高度的兼容性,成为了众多开发者和管理员的首选
本文将详细介绍如何使用Navicat来高效地输入和管理MySQL数据库,帮助您在工作中事半功倍
一、Navicat简介与安装 Navicat是一款由PremiumSoft CyberTech Ltd.开发的数据库管理工具,支持多种数据库类型,包括MySQL、MariaDB、MongoDB、SQLite、Oracle、PostgreSQL和SQL Server等
它提供了丰富的功能,如表设计、数据导入导出、数据同步、备份恢复等,极大地简化了数据库管理工作
安装Navicat 1.下载Navicat:首先,您需要从Navicat的官方网站或其他可信渠道下载适用于您操作系统的Navicat版本
Navicat提供了Windows、macOS、Linux等多个平台的版本
2.安装过程:下载完成后,双击安装包并按照提示进行安装
在安装过程中,您可能需要选择安装路径、是否创建桌面快捷方式等选项
3.启动Navicat:安装完成后,双击Navicat的图标启动软件
如果是首次启动,您可能需要输入注册码或登录您的Navicat账号以解锁全部功能
二、连接到MySQL数据库 在使用Navicat输入MySQL数据库之前,您需要先建立与数据库的连接
以下是连接MySQL数据库的步骤: 1.创建新连接:在Navicat的主界面中,点击左上角的“连接”按钮,选择“MySQL”作为数据库类型
2.填写连接信息:在弹出的连接窗口中,您需要填写数据库的连接信息,包括主机名(或IP地址)、端口号(默认为3306)、用户名和密码
如果您需要连接到远程数据库,请确保您的MySQL服务器允许远程连接,并且防火墙设置允许相应的端口通信
3.测试连接:填写完连接信息后,点击“测试连接”按钮以验证信息的正确性
如果连接成功,您将看到提示信息;如果连接失败,请检查您的连接信息是否正确,以及MySQL服务器是否正在运行
4.保存连接:测试连接成功后,点击“确定”按钮保存连接
此时,您将在Navicat的连接列表中看到新创建的MySQL连接
三、使用Navicat输入MySQL数据 1. 创建新数据库和表 在成功连接到MySQL数据库后,您可以开始创建新的数据库和表
-创建数据库:在连接列表中右键点击您的MySQL连接,选择“新建数据库”,然后输入数据库名称并点击“确定”
-创建表:在数据库名称上右键点击,选择“新建表”
在弹出的表设计窗口中,您可以设置表的字段名称、数据类型、约束条件等
完成设计后,点击“保存”按钮以创建表
2. 输入数据 创建好表之后,您可以开始输入数据
-直接输入:在表名称上双击,或者在右键菜单中选择“打开表”,您将看到表的编辑界面
在这里,您可以逐行输入数据
Navicat提供了方便的编辑功能,如复制粘贴、批量编辑等
-导入数据:如果您已经有现成的数据文件(如CSV、Excel等),您可以使用Navicat的导入功能将数据快速导入到表中
在表名称上右键点击,选择“导入向导”,然后按照提示选择文件类型和导入选项
3. 查询与更新数据 Navicat不仅支持数据的输入,还提供了强大的查询和更新功能
-运行SQL查询:在连接列表或数据库名称上右键点击,选择“新建查询”
在弹出的查询窗口中,您可以输入SQL语句来查询或更新数据
Navicat提供了语法高亮、自动补全等辅助功能,帮助您快速编写和执行SQL语句
-图形化查询设计器:对于不熟悉SQL语法的用户,Navicat还提供了图形化的查询设计器
您可以通过拖拽字段和设置条件来构建查询,然后生成相应的SQL语句并执行
4. 数据备份与恢复 为了保护数据的安全性,定期备份数据库是非常重要的
Navicat提供了便捷的数据备份与恢复功能
-备份数据库:在连接列表或数据库名称上右键点击,选择“数据备份”
在弹出的窗口中,您可以设置备份文件的保存路径、备份类型(完全备份、增量备份等)以及备份选项
点击“开始”按钮即可执行备份操作
-恢复数据库:如果需要恢复备份的数据,您可以在连接列表上右键点击,选择“数据恢复”
在弹出的窗口中,选择您要恢复的备份文件,并设置恢复选项
点击“开始”按钮即可执行恢复操作
四、Navicat的高级功能 除了基本的数据库管理和数据输入功能外,Navicat还提供了一些高级功能,以满足更复杂的需求
1. 数据同步 Navicat的数据同步功能可以帮助您在不同数据库之间同步数据,确保数据的一致性和完整性
您可以选择同步表结构、数据或两者都同步
同步过程中,Navicat会智能地比较源数据库和目标数据库之间的差异,并生成相应的SQL语句来执行同步操作
2.自动化任务 Navicat支持设置自动化任务,如定时备份、定时同步等
您可以在Navicat的“自动化”菜单中创建和管理自动化任务
通过设置触发条件和执行动作,您可以实现数据库的自动化管理,提高工作效率
3.团队协作 Navicat提供了团队协作功能,允许多个用户同时连接到同一个数据库并进行操作
通过权限管理功能,您可以为不同用户设置不同的访问权限和操作权限,确保数据库的安全性和数据的完整性
五、总结 Navicat作为一款功能强大的数据库管理工具,为MySQL数据库的输入和管理提供了极大的便利
通过本文的介绍,您已经了解了如何使用Navicat连接到MySQL数据库、创建数据库和表、输入数据、查询与更新数据以及进行数据备份与恢复等基本操作
此外,Navicat还提供了数据同步、自动化任务和团队协作等高级功能,进一步提高了数据库管理的效率和灵活性
如果您正在寻找一款高效、易用、功能全面的数据库管理工具,那么Navicat无疑是您的理想选择
C语言与MySQL:深入理解存储过程返回值类型
Navicat连接MySQL数据库教程
易语言快速搭建MySQL数据库指南
MySQL:INSERT结合JOIN高效数据录入
MySQL数据库ER图详解指南
驱动包与MySQL版本匹配指南
MySQL执行语句全攻略
C语言与MySQL:深入理解存储过程返回值类型
易语言快速搭建MySQL数据库指南
MySQL:INSERT结合JOIN高效数据录入
MySQL数据库ER图详解指南
驱动包与MySQL版本匹配指南
MySQL执行语句全攻略
MySQL排他锁在UPDATE操作中的应用
MySQL性能瓶颈揭秘:没有索引字如何拖慢你的数据库查询?
区块链VS MySQL:数据库革新差异解析
MySQL连接:如何正确填写IP地址
速解MySQL远程连接慢问题攻略
MySQL视图新建:轻松提升数据查询效率